Pirok pleads guilty to driving under influence

By Mike Monson
Saturday, September 30, 2006 9:29 AM CDT

CHAMPAIGN – Champaign City Council member Ken Pirok pleaded guilty Friday to driving under the influence, but had other traffic charges against him, including failure to report an accident and improper backing, dismissed.

Pirok was sentenced to 12 months of court supervision, fined $700 and must do 150 hours of community service work, according to the negotiated plea agreement that was approved Friday by Associate Judge Richard Klaus in Champaign County Circuit Court.
